Summary
Laparoscopic Heller myotomy and Dor fundoplication (LHD) is superior to pneumatic dilatation for esophageal achalasia treatment. Careful surgical technique during LHD is crucial for optimal patient outcomes and avoiding complications.

Summary:
- Two prospective randomized studies indicate LHD is superior to pneumatic dilatation for esophageal achalasia.
- Key LHD considerations include careful division of short gastric vessels, meticulous esophageal myotomy to avoid mucosal injury, and loose fundoplication to prevent postoperative dysphagia.
- Mucosal injury during myotomy necessitates repair with absorbable sutures and intracorporeal knot tying.

Esophageal Achalasia
Esophageal achalasia is a chronic neurogenic disorder characterized by impaired relaxation of the lower esophageal sphincter (LES) and absent or ineffective peristalsis in the distal esophagus. Esophageal Strictures-II: Clinical Features and Management
Patients with esophageal strictures often experience a range of symptoms. Initially, they may have difficulty swallowing solid foods, which can progress to include liquids. Additional symptoms may involve chest pain or discomfort, regurgitating food and fluids, heartburn, unintentional weight loss, coughing or choking during meals, and hoarseness.
